Why the Betrayal of a Homegrown Star Still Hurts More Than Any Match Loss

The Anatomy of Broken Trust

I’ve analyzed thousands of player transfers using R and Python—predicting movement patterns based on contract terms, regional ties, and performance clusters. But nothing in my models prepared me for this: a homegrown talent leaving his boyhood club for their most hated rival, not with a handshake or farewell tour—but via clause activation.

It’s like finding out your favorite algorithm was trained on false data. You can’t trust the output anymore.

“He Walked with the Monsters”

Joan Cuyadet, former president of Espanyol, didn’t yell. He didn’t curse. He said simply: “He walked with the monsters.” That line hit me harder than any stats report.

This wasn’t just moving teams—it was moving sides in a war you didn’t know had begun. For fans raised on local pride and identity politics (especially here in Chicago where loyalty to your neighborhood is sacred), this feels personal.

When Loyalty Isn’t Just Emotion — It’s Data

Let’s get technical for a second: Espanyol didn’t want to sell him to Barça. They triggered his release clause only after pressure—and even then, they were forced into it by contract mechanics.

But that doesn’t erase the psychological cost.

In behavioral economics, we call this ‘loss aversion’—people feel losses more acutely than gains. Imagine being part of a system that nurtured you from age 8… only to see you walk away without saying goodbye—not even watching your own farewell video.

That’s real cognitive dissonance.

The Unspoken Rules of Football Loyalty

I grew up watching baseball in Chicago—the Cubs vs White Sox rivalry was never about winning or losing it all; it was about who belonged where. And if you came from Comiskey Park? You stayed there—or at least left with respect.

Same here in Spain. Kids wear their club jersey like armor. They learn chants before they learn how to read.

When one leaves under shadow—especially for a city enemy—it breaks something fundamental: the social contract between player and fan base.

No amount of stats can measure that fracture.
